Pierpont Inn was the vision of wealthy socialite Mrs. Pierpont-Ginn. It was built in 1910 as a Craftsman-style bungalow. It has been a Ventura landmark ever since. The 12-acre property boasts breathtaking Pacific Ocean views, gourmet dining at Austen’s Restaurant and ­­­­landscaping that doesn’t feel over-manicured.

Owned and operated by the Vickers family since 1928, the Inn offers the type of warmth only family-style hospitality can provide. Visitors looking to experience local culture should book one of Pierpont’s eight historic suites which celebrate the diverse architecture of the 20th century.

In its previous life, the Victorian Rose was a church and wedding chapel. Today, it welcomes visitors looking for a unique sleep. Guests will love the Victorian Rose for unabashed and authentic room features including (but certainly not limited to!) fireplaces, stained glass and ornate woodwork.

You don’t have to go all the way to the Caribbean to find all-suite beachfront resort bliss. Oxnard is home to the glamorous Embassy Suites Mandalay Beach Hotel & Resort, sitting atop 8.5 acres of gorgeous landscaping.

All 250 of the rooms are newly renovated yet maintain traditional coastal charm. Canadian travellers will love the towering palms, exotic gardens and lagoon pool with cascading waterfalls.

This eye-catching hotel offers sunset marina views, does it get any better? Sip coffee from your patio overlooking the harbour while admiring the gentle rocking of docked sailboats. The Hampton Inn is modern, unpretentious and perched near a neighborhood of relaxing sunsets and adventurous activities. Located in the Channel Islands Harbor, it’s the perfect launch pad for exploring the Channel Islands, venturing on whale watching excursions or simply sampling the day’s fresh catch.

Vagabond Inn Ventura’s charm is obvious to us; its low rise construction, peaked porte-cochère and spunky sign have a distinctly Route 66 feel. (Though we can’t promise its charms will woo everyone!)

The Inn’s 70 rooms are clean and basic, and just a few blocks walk to Historic Old Town. After a day of exploring the Ventura County Coast, retreat to the Inn and take a dip in the heated swimming pool. Bonus: this hotel is pet friendly.

Casa Via Mar Inn has a Spanish flair but inside you’ll find Classic California alive and kicking. Contained within its hacienda-style exterior are tidy rooms and décor that nods to the days of surfboards strapped to wood-paneled station wagons. Located on a charming, pedestrian-friendly street, Bella Maggiore is just three blocks from the beach and even closer to the pretty-as-a-picture Ventura City Hall. The Inn romantically draws on Mediterranean-style décor and furnishings, and offers European hospitality. Guests will swoon for rooms outfitted with Capuan beds, shuttered windows and fresh-picked florals. But more than that, we love the social spaces Bella Maggiore offers, from the sun deck roof garden to the flower-filled courtyard to the lobby’s cozy fireplace.
